Peskov: Putin ready for talks with Macron

Kremlin spokesperson Dmitry Peskov on Sunday said Russian President Vladimir Putin is ready to engage in dialogue with French President Emmanuel Macron.
“He [Macron] spoke about his readiness to talk to Putin. It is very important, probably, to recall what the President [Putin] said during the direct line. He also expressed his readiness to engage in dialogue with Macron. Therefore, if there is mutual political will, then this can only be assessed positively”, Peskov said.
Two days earlier, Macron said Europe would need to find its own way to engage directly with Putin, rather than relying solely on the United States, which is actively facilitating peace efforts.
“Either a lasting peace will be achieved, or we will find ways for Europeans to resume dialogue with Russia - through transparency and in coordination with Ukraine. It would be useful to speak with Putin again,” Macron said, stressing that Europe demands a seat at the table in peace negotiations over Ukraine.
Macron’s remarks came after EU leaders decided on Friday to provide Ukraine with €90 billion in loans for 2026–2027, abandoning the idea of confiscating frozen Russian assets.
